ARA Sends Comment to EPA on Evaluation of Existing Regulations
May 15 2017
ARA sends comments to the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) on the evaluation of existing regulations in accordance with Executive Order (EO) 13777, Enforcing the Regulatory Reform Agenda.
ARA comments on the following topics associated with EPA regulations:
- Restore the principle of scientific risk-based regulation as required by FIRFA and push back against efforts to change it to hazard-based as unscientific and harmful to innovation and public health.
- Restoring science and predictability to the pesticide registration process
- NPDES Pesticide General Permitting requirements
- Pesticide Registration Improvement Act (PRIA)
- Annual Pesticide Production Reports – EPA Form 3540-16
- Agricultural Worker Protect Standards (WPS)
- Certified Applicator & Training Rules
- Risk Management Program (RMP)
- SARA Tier II Reports (40 CFR 370.20)
- Spill Prevention, Control, and Countermeasures (SPCC)
- Waters of the US (WOTUS) Rule
- General Duty Clause
- Focus on Compliance Assistance
